About Ethan

Ethan the Ezrahite was a wise man during the time of King Solomon. He was known for his wisdom, although not as wise as Solomon himself (1Ki.4.31). Ethan was also a skilled musician and is credited with authoring Psalm 89, a psalm that reflects on God's covenant with David and the challenges faced by the Davidic dynasty (Psalm 1Ki.89.1). The psalm demonstrates Ethan's deep understanding of God's faithfulness and sovereignty.
